Search engine optimization has evolved from a manual, spreadsheet-driven discipline into a data-rich, automation-powered ecosystem. Today, businesses, agencies, and software platforms rely on SEO APIs to access accurate rank tracking, detailed backlink profiles, and real-time SERP data at scale. Whether you are building an internal dashboard, running competitive intelligence analysis, or creating a SaaS SEO tool, choosing the right API provider can dramatically impact performance, accuracy, and costs.
TLDR: The best SEO API providers offer scalable access to keyword rankings, backlink intelligence, and detailed SERP data. Leaders like Semrush, Ahrefs, DataForSEO, SerpApi, and Moz each specialize in different strengths, from database depth to real-time SERP scraping. Your choice should depend on data freshness, geographic coverage, API limits, and budget. Understanding your specific use case is the key to selecting the right solution.
In this guide, we’ll explore the top SEO API providers, break down their strengths, and help you determine which option aligns best with your technical and business goals.
What to Look for in an SEO API Provider
Before diving into specific platforms, it’s important to understand what separates a high-quality SEO API from a mediocre one.
- Accuracy and freshness of data – How often is the index updated?
- Global coverage – Does it support multiple countries and languages?
- Rate limits and scalability – Can it handle large-scale applications?
- Backlink database size – How comprehensive is the link index?
- SERP feature tracking – Does it capture featured snippets, maps, images, and shopping results?
- Transparent pricing – Are costs predictable as usage scales?
With these factors in mind, let’s explore the most trusted providers in the industry.
1. Semrush API
Semrush is widely recognized for its all-in-one SEO platform, and its API extends powerful capabilities to developers and enterprise users.
Best for: Competitive analysis, keyword research, and backlink audits at scale.
Key features include:
- Extensive keyword database across 140+ countries
- Domain and URL-level backlink analytics
- Historical keyword ranking data
- Competitor traffic estimation
One of Semrush’s strengths is its comprehensive ecosystem. You can pull ranking data, analyze competitors, and generate backlink reports through a single integration.
Drawback: Pricing can be high for large API usage tiers, making it more suitable for mid-sized agencies and enterprises than small startups.
2. Ahrefs API
Ahrefs is famous for its vast backlink index and powerful link analysis capabilities. Its API provides structured access to much of that data.
Best for: Link building analysis and competitive backlink research.
Notable strengths:
- Massive live backlink index
- Detailed anchor text and referring domain data
- Domain Rating (DR) and URL Rating (UR) metrics
- Content gap and competitor insights
Ahrefs is particularly valuable for companies building tools focused on authority metrics, spam detection, or influencer discovery.
However, Ahrefs API access is more restricted than some competitors, and usage can be expensive depending on the data volume required.
3. DataForSEO API
DataForSEO has earned a reputation as one of the most flexible and developer-friendly SEO API providers available.
Best for: Custom applications, automation tools, and startups needing scalable data at competitive prices.
What makes DataForSEO stand out:
- Pay-as-you-go pricing model
- Live SERP data collection
- Keyword search volume and difficulty metrics
- Google Maps and local SEO data
- App store and ecommerce SERP tracking
Its infrastructure is particularly well-suited for companies building SEO SaaS platforms. Developers appreciate the granular endpoints and task-based system that allows precise data requests.
Drawback: While powerful, the platform may require more technical expertise compared to plug-and-play enterprise solutions.
4. SerpApi
SerpApi specializes in real-time search engine results page scraping through a clean, structured API.
Best for: Real-time SERP analysis and feature tracking.
Unlike some providers that rely heavily on historical databases, SerpApi pulls live search results directly from search engines.
- Real-time Google, Bing, and Yahoo SERPs
- Support for Google Images, News, Shopping
- Featured snippet and People Also Ask tracking
- Structured JSON output
This makes it a strong choice for applications that require up-to-the-minute accuracy, such as monitoring volatile keyword rankings or tracking news-based queries.
Drawback: It focuses primarily on SERP extraction rather than deep backlink intelligence.
5. Moz API
Moz has long been a recognizable name in SEO, and its API provides access to its well-known authority metrics and link data.
Best for: Domain authority scoring and foundational backlink research.
Popular features include:
- Domain Authority (DA) and Page Authority (PA)
- Spam score metrics
- Linking domains and anchor text data
- Keyword difficulty estimates
Moz’s authority metrics are widely referenced in the marketing industry, making its API useful for reporting tools and dashboards that need recognizable scoring systems.
However, compared to Ahrefs and Semrush, Moz’s backlink index is generally considered smaller.
6. Bright Data (SERP API)
Bright Data offers enterprise-grade data collection solutions, including powerful SERP APIs.
Best for: Large-scale scraping and enterprise-level data acquisition.
It provides:
- Highly customizable SERP scraping
- Geo-targeted results
- Device-specific search simulation
- Advanced proxy infrastructure
This level of control makes it attractive for enterprises conducting large-scale competitive intelligence or market research campaigns.
Drawback: Overkill (and expensive) for smaller SEO teams needing straightforward rank tracking.
Key Differences: Rank Tracking vs Backlink vs SERP APIs
Not all SEO APIs serve the same purpose. Understanding the distinction helps clarify your choice.
Rank Tracking APIs
- Monitor keyword positions over time
- Support multiple locations and devices
- Often provide historical trend data
Backlink APIs
- Provide link indexes and authority scores
- Identify referring domains and anchor text
- Useful for link audits and outreach campaigns
SERP Data APIs
- Deliver real-time search results
- Capture SERP features like maps and snippets
- Useful for competitive intelligence and UI analysis
Some platforms offer all three, while others specialize deeply in one category.
How to Choose the Right SEO API
To make the best decision, ask yourself the following questions:
- Are you building a product or internal tool? Product builders often benefit from flexible APIs like DataForSEO or SerpApi.
- Is backlink intelligence your priority? Ahrefs or Semrush may be ideal.
- Do you need real-time SERP accuracy? SerpApi or Bright Data might be better suited.
- What is your monthly query volume? Pay-as-you-go models reduce financial risk in early stages.
- Do you need well-known authority metrics for reporting? Moz provides widely recognized scores.
Budget, technical skill level, and long-term scalability should also factor heavily into your decision.
Final Thoughts
The SEO landscape is becoming increasingly automated and data-centric. APIs are no longer optional tools reserved for large enterprises—they are fundamental building blocks for modern SEO workflows.
The best provider depends on your purpose:
- Choose Semrush or Ahrefs for comprehensive competitive intelligence.
- Choose DataForSEO for flexibility and scalable integration.
- Choose SerpApi for real-time SERP tracking.
- Choose Moz for authority metrics and standardized scoring.
- Choose Bright Data for enterprise-level scraping infrastructure.
Ultimately, the right SEO API is the one that aligns technical capability with business objectives. When chosen strategically, it can power smarter decisions, automate complex workflows, and unlock competitive insights that manual analysis simply cannot match.
As search engines evolve and SERPs grow more dynamic, the demand for reliable, structured SEO data will only increase. Investing in the right API today positions your organization to adapt, compete, and thrive in the data-driven search ecosystem of tomorrow.